About This Item
London: George Routledge (1888). (Cloth) 64pp. Good to very good. Illus. Light wear to edges of boards with otherwise very minor rubs and marks. Front hinge tender. Former owner's name verso endpaper. Occasional light foxing, spotting. A couple of very short closed tears to page edges. A highly acceptable copy. Thompson 17A. Schuster & Engen 157. Osborne 11:52-53..
